// REINDEX_BATCH_CAP limits docs per shard pass in the Tallowfield
// nightly search reindex. Raising it starves the ingest queue;
// lowering it overruns the maintenance window. 5000 is the tested
// sweet spot. Change only with a soak run. Verified against the
// build noted below.

session token of bawif-hahog = htk6_ac5981

## Scanner Integration: Recovery Steps

If the Bravelock scanner bridge stops acknowledging scans, restart the bridge process first; do not power-cycle the scanner. Plugin authors: your decode hooks run after checksum validation, never before. Failed decodes go to the dead-letter queue and replay automatically every five minutes. If replays stack up past 500, throttle your hook or the bridge drops connections. All timing and queue behavior is controlled by the settings shown here.

settings of yageg-yahap:
[gorael]
team = olieth
access_code = ac_941d74
owner = brieth.aldiel
host = gorael.tolvaqio.internal
port = 6379
peer = briwyn.urlaqtech.internal
salt = 116e6622
pin = 1957

**Audit Item 7 — Profiler Instrumentation Review.** As a new contractor, verify that the VramScope profiling agent is pinned to the approved build and that allocation snapshots are scrubbed of tenant identifiers before export. Confirm sampling intervals match the values in the Kestrelworks tooling baseline, and record any deviation in the audit log. If anything is unclear, the accountable owner for this item is listed below.

approver of bagug-bagag = Holael Pramir

## Auth

Quillpad wiki uses role-based access: viewer, editor, admin. Roles map from Lanternway groups; sync runs hourly. Admin grants go through the access board, not direct edits. For this week's sync: the permissions migration is done, legacy tokens are revoked Friday. Service-to-service calls (search indexer, export bot) authenticate against the Quillpad internal API with a shared key. That key is below.

service key, bajog-yahop: kto7_mMHVCpJ